X-Git-Url: http://git.hungrycats.org/cgi-bin/gitweb.cgi?p=xscreensaver;a=blobdiff_plain;f=OSX%2FXScreenSaverGLView.m;h=da155211a3c058f32d5f7a5424179cf519be41c8;hp=f7a58c481bd4f04d2c287fde7092d5ac2e6d9ac1;hb=c70f94f648d51bb4828193124f325fa52b0e57f3;hpb=f8cf5ac7b2f53510f80a0eaf286a25298be17bfe diff --git a/OSX/XScreenSaverGLView.m b/OSX/XScreenSaverGLView.m index f7a58c48..da155211 100644 --- a/OSX/XScreenSaverGLView.m +++ b/OSX/XScreenSaverGLView.m @@ -371,6 +371,9 @@ init_GL (ModeInfo *mi) [NSNumber numberWithBool:!dbuf_p], kEAGLDrawablePropertyRetainedBacking, nil]; + // Without this, the GL frame buffer is half the screen resolution! + eagl_layer.contentsScale = [UIScreen mainScreen].scale; + ogl_ctx = [[EAGLContext alloc] initWithAPI:kEAGLRenderingAPIOpenGLES1]; }